There is SO MUCH to love about this Historical Romance!! TW: Domestic Abuse, Emotional Abuse, War related PTSD, Survivors Guilt, POW cruelty. Let's start with the fact that it is for all intents and purposes, a single parent romance. Both Jamie and Abigail are written appropriately for their age, and don't get tiresome on page. I enjoyed being in Abigail's perspective on occasion, because it was a way to help the story, but the narrative was true to that of a nine year old girl. Our female protagonist, Helen, is my kind of woman. She got into a bad situation really young, and tried to make the best of it. When it was clear it could never work in a way that was good for her, or her children, she does what she can. She asks for help and runs away from the person she is held captive by because he treats her like a posession, and not a person. Call Me Maybe by Cara Bastone 🌟🌟🌟🌟🌟 Vera is making her dream of working for herself come true.  She has just one hangup left.  Her website is in SHAMBLES!!!  When she calls the customer service line for her website host, she isn't expecting the fun and flirty Cal on the other end of the line. He helps make this stressful situation easier to navigate, and helps her want to believe in love again.  Maybe she will take her brother up on the offer of setting her up with Fred. Cal wasn't expecting to have such a complicated customer service call, but is thoroughly entertained by the lovely Vera on the other end of the line.  He feels bad as he looks down at his bare feet and casual attire talking to her. Maybe he should dress up? Maybe he should ask her out?  Who knows. Maybe he should call his best friend and ask him what to think.  After all, he's just a programmer helping someone with a problem.   Someday My Duke Will Come (Isle of Synne #2) by Christina Britton I was blown away by book 2 in the Isle of Synne series! I cried more than once reading this.  Tropes you will find: Fake Betrothal, From Spare to Heir, Older Heroine/Younger Hero, (not by much,) Friends to Lovers, Spinster Bride Trigger Warnings: Loss of a parent, loss of a child, loss of a sibling, verbal abuse from a parent. This book was BEAUTIFULLY crafted, and I am so glad it is the first official book I finished in 2021.  Quincy is the kind of hero that I love. He ran away from home as a teenager when his mother wanted to ship him off to the Navy right after the passing of his father. By taking matters into his own hands, he becomes a made man in America, and meets his best friend who is more like a brother than any of his 3 blood brothers.
